Comprehending Shipping Containers
Shipping containers are big standardized steel boxes designed for transferring items. They are available in different sizes-- most typically 20-foot and 40-foot containers-- and are used in both maritime and overland logistics. Their robust design permits safe and efficient transport throughout various modes of transport.

The use of shipping containers for delivery provides a number of advantages:
1. Security
Shipping containers are created to be tamper-proof, providing an added layer of security for products in transit.
2. Cost-Effectiveness
Shipping by container can lower transportation costs as they enable bulk shipping.
3. Intermodal Flexibility
Containers can be transferred in between various modes of transport without discharging their contents.
4. Standardization
The standardized sizes and requirements help with simpler loading, unloading, and stacking.
5. Environmental Impact
More efficient transportation approaches result in lowered carbon emissions per lots of cargo transported.
